RE: Re: Black Dyke Hymn Book



The Salvation Army has recently published up-beat arrangements for brass
band of new/contemporary praise and worship songs, a-la Graham Kendrick.
(Methinks:  "Hymns - such an old fashioned word")

These include
*	There is a redeemer
*	From Heaven You Came
*	Lord, I Come to You
*	Come On and Celebrate
*	Majesty
*	And a contemporary arrangement of "Send the Fire"
*	Plus a stirring fanfare-type arrangement of "Praise my Soul"

I believe most arrangements were executed by Robert Redhead, and Richard
Phillips, all with intros to lead the singing.
Both are well-known in SA circles for their compositions, particularly
Richard for contemporary Christian-themed band music
